Geoboard Schema Injector is a lightweight WordPress plugin that auto-injects Schema.org JSON-LD into your site’s <head> on every page load, making your site more visible to AI search engines.
It connects to your existing Geoboard.ai account (a SaaS service for Generative Engine Optimization) and fetches the schema generated for your brand — Organization, FAQPage, Service, and more.
Unlike JavaScript-based schema injection (which AI crawlers like GPTBot and ClaudeBot ignore because they don’t execute JS), Geoboard Schema Injector outputs the schema directly into the HTML response. This means:
Geoboard Schema Injector can also publish a /llms.txt file at your site root, following the llms.txt standard — an emerging convention for AI assistants to discover what your site is about (similar to robots.txt for search engines).
The plugin auto-generates a default template from your site title, tagline, and recent pages. You can also paste custom markdown content in the settings page.
Enable in Settings Geoboard Schema Injector /llms.txt for AI crawlers.
<head> on every page.Geoboard Schema Injector caches the schema locally for 24 hours to avoid hitting the API on every page load. You can manually refresh anytime from the settings page.
Geoboard Schema Injector works with all Geoboard.ai plans, with feature scope based on your subscription:
The Free plan does not require a credit card and includes a 30-day Geoboard Schema Injector trial.
This plugin communicates with geoboard.ai (operated by Premiumads sp. z o.o., Poland) to fetch your Schema.org JSON-LD.
https://geoboard.ai/wp-json/pa-geo/v1/geoboost/schema/{api_key}No visitor data is transmitted. The plugin does not track or analyze your site visitors.
Terms of service: geoboard.ai/regulamin/
Privacy policy: geoboard.ai/polityka-prywatnosci/